Overview

Our Museum brings to life the history and ongoing development of computing for inspiration, research, learning and enjoyment for the benefit of general and specialist publics of all ages.
We have expert volunteers and guides who are available to explain and demonstrate our working collection.
Hear the story of the exhibits and artefacts as well as the inspirational people involved.

Visit: The National Museum of Computing, Block H Bletchley Park, Bletchley, Milton Keynes MK3 6EB England

The National Museum of Computing (TNMOC) is home to the world's largest collection of working historic computers.

Follow the development of computing: from the Turing-Welchman Bombe, Enigma, Lorenz and Colossus of the 1940s through the large systems and mainframes of the 1950s, 60s and 70s, to the rise of personal computing, retro games and the rise of mobile computing and the internet.
Recognised as one of England’s top 100 ‘irreplaceable places’, we welcome corporate and group visits, schools and individuals from all over the world.
